The county was named for Benjamin Franklin
Franklin County is one of 62 counties in New York.
The county is in the Malone metro area.The estimated population in 2004 was 51,009. This was a decrease of -.24% from the 2000 census.
Median household income
Local $31,517
National $41,994
Source: 2000 census, U.S. Census Bureau

In 2002, the per capita personal income in Franklin County was $20,232. This was an increase of 21.8% from 1997. The 2002 figure was 65% of the national per capita income, which was $30,906.
County seat: Malone (http://www.epodunk.com/cgi-bin/genInfo.php?locIndex=1091)
